Summary:This manuscript represents a virtual assistant developed with modern computation named after “JERRY”. The proposed model is entirely based on the new Internet of things (IoT) mechanism and Natural Language Processing (NLP). Experimental data analysis on the virtual assistant is also enumerated and interpreted to find the proposed system’s feasibility. The accomplished experiments are the practicability testing of the virtual assistant, how the users will be able to interact with home automation in AC supply, a comparison on response time among existing solutions and System Usability Scale (SUS) to check the random user’s satisfaction level. Average response time of 1.93 is tracked out, which is more impressive than other available intelligent assistants in the global market. SUS score of 98% is also found. Though the proposed model has some limitations, a reliable smart assistant for regular activities and an interactive home automation system is developed. However, the proposed architecture can be adjustable in the regular activities of the general users.
